North Lanarkshire's sports and leisure facilities are closing due to Coronavirus

North Lanarkshire leisure and culture facilities are closing their doors from the end of today (Tuesday) in line with government advice on how to reduce social contact in the Coronavirus outbreak.

All of their culture and leisure facilities will be closed for the foreseeable future, and applies to all sports and leisure facilites including gyms, swimming pools, golf courses and driving ranges, community centres and school letting, libraries, including mobile services, museums, including North Lanarkshire Heritage Centre, Motherwell Theatre and Concert Hall, Airdrie Town Hall and Bellshill Cultural Centre, community arts classes and sport development activitiy, and cafes at country parks.

All NL Leisure memberships and direct debits will be temporarily suspended automatically and there will be direct contact with members in the coming days.

A North Lanaksshire Leisure spokesperson said: "These are very challenging times for everyone and we appreciate your understanding, support and co-operation."
